How Does Tokenization Work?
Understanding the Tokenization Process
Tokenization is the process of converting ownership rights in a real-world asset into blockchain-based digital tokens.
These digital tokens can represent ownership interests, economic rights, debt obligations, revenue streams, or other forms of value tied to physical assets or traditional financial instruments.
While the technology behind tokenization may seem complex, the overall process follows a structured framework that combines legal, financial, and blockchain infrastructure.
Understanding how tokenization works is essential for asset owners, investors, fund managers, issuers, and institutions exploring the future of digital finance.

Step 1: Asset Selection
The process begins by identifying an asset suitable for tokenization.
Examples include:
Commercial Real Estate
An office building, apartment complex, hotel, or industrial property.
Investment Fund
A venture capital, private equity, hedge fund, or real estate fund.
Private Credit Portfolio
Loans, receivables, or lending products.
Bond Issuance
Corporate, municipal, or sovereign debt instruments.
Once selected, the asset undergoes legal, financial, and operational review.
Step 2: Legal Structuring
Legal structuring is one of the most important aspects of tokenization.
The blockchain token itself does not create ownership rights. The legal framework surrounding the token determines what rights investors receive.
Common structures include:
Special Purpose Vehicles (SPVs)
A legal entity is created to hold the underlying asset.
Investors purchase tokens representing ownership interests in the SPV.
Funds
Investment funds may issue tokenized interests representing ownership in the fund.
Corporate Structures
Tokens may represent equity, debt, revenue participation, or other economic interests.
Trust Structures
Assets may be held through trusts that provide ownership and investor protections.
Legal documentation defines:
- Investor rights
- Ownership interests
- Voting rights
- Revenue participation
- Dividend distributions
- Transfer restrictions
- Compliance requirements
Step 3: Token Design
Once legal structures are established, the digital token is designed.
Questions addressed include:
- What does the token represent?
- Who can own the token?
- What rights does the token holder receive?
- How are transfers managed?
- What compliance rules apply?
Examples include:
Equity Tokens
Represent ownership interests.
Debt Tokens
Represent lending or debt obligations.
Revenue Sharing Tokens
Provide rights to future revenues or cash flows.
Asset-Backed Tokens
Represent ownership tied to specific assets.
Step 4: Smart Contract Development
Smart contracts serve as the operational engine of tokenized assets.
A smart contract is software deployed on a blockchain that automatically executes predefined rules.
Smart contracts may manage:
- Ownership records
- Investor permissions
- Transfer restrictions
- Compliance requirements
- Dividend distributions
- Interest payments
- Voting rights
- Reporting functions
Because smart contracts are programmable, many manual administrative tasks can be automated.
Step 5: Compliance & Investor Onboarding
Most tokenized securities and investment products require investor verification.
This process typically includes:
KYC (Know Your Customer)
Verifying investor identity.
AML (Anti-Money Laundering)
Screening investors against regulatory databases.
Accreditation Verification
Confirming eligibility when required.
Jurisdictional Compliance
Ensuring investors meet local regulatory requirements.
Compliance remains one of the most important components of successful tokenization.
Step 6: Token Issuance
Once legal, technical, and compliance requirements are completed, tokens are issued.
The issuance process creates blockchain-based ownership units representing the underlying asset.
Investors receive tokens in digital wallets that serve as proof of ownership.
Ownership records are maintained on blockchain infrastructure.
Step 7: Asset Management & Administration
Following issuance, the asset continues to be managed by the issuer, fund manager, or asset operator.
Administrative functions may include:
- Investor reporting
- Asset performance updates
- Compliance monitoring
- Dividend distributions
- Interest payments
- Financial reporting
Many of these activities can be partially automated using smart contracts and digital infrastructure.
Step 8: Secondary Trading
One of the most discussed benefits of tokenization is the potential for secondary market activity.
Investors may be able to transfer or sell tokenized ownership interests through:
- Alternative Trading Systems (ATS)
- Digital Securities Exchanges
- Secondary Trading Platforms
- Peer-to-Peer Transfers
- Institutional Marketplaces
Secondary market infrastructure continues to evolve as the industry matures.

Example: Tokenizing a Real Estate Property
Imagine a commercial office building valued at $20 million.
Traditional Ownership
One investor purchases the property.
Tokenized Ownership
The property is placed into a legal structure.
20 million digital tokens are created.
Each token represents a fractional ownership interest.
Investors purchase tokens representing their proportional ownership.
Income generated by the property can be distributed automatically based on ownership percentages.
This creates a more accessible investment structure while maintaining legal ownership protections.

Challenges in Tokenization
Despite significant progress, challenges remain.
Regulatory Complexity
Rules vary by jurisdiction.
Secondary Liquidity
Many markets are still developing.
Custody Infrastructure
Institutional-grade solutions continue to mature.
Market Adoption
Education and awareness remain important.
Interoperability
Systems and networks must work together seamlessly.
The Future of Tokenization
Many of the world's largest financial institutions are actively building tokenization initiatives.
BlackRock, Franklin Templeton, JPMorgan, UBS, HSBC, and numerous governments are exploring tokenized funds, bonds, deposits, private markets, and real-world assets.
As infrastructure, regulation, and adoption continue to advance, tokenization is expected to become an increasingly important component of global financial markets.
